1. What is the HVAC Sizing Calculation?

The HVAC sizing calculation estimates the required cooling capacity (in tons) for a space based on its area and climate factors. Proper sizing is crucial for energy efficiency and comfort.

2. How Does the Calculator Work?

The calculator uses the HVAC sizing formula:

\[ Tons = \frac{Area \times Factor}{12000} \]

Explanation: The equation converts the total BTU requirement (area × factor) into tons of cooling capacity.

3. Importance of Proper HVAC Sizing

Details: Correct HVAC sizing prevents energy waste, ensures proper dehumidification, extends equipment life, and maintains comfort levels.

4. Using the Calculator

Tips: Measure your total square footage accurately. Choose appropriate BTU factor: 20-30 for moderate climates, 30-40 for hot/humid climates.

5. Frequently Asked Questions (FAQ)

Q1: What's the typical BTU factor for my region?
A: Northern climates: 20-25, Moderate climates: 25-30, Southern/hot climates: 30-40 BTU/sq ft.

Q2: Why is oversizing bad?
A: Oversized units short-cycle, reducing efficiency, increasing wear, and failing to dehumidify properly.

Q3: What if my home is well insulated?
A: Well-insulated homes may use lower BTU factors (20-25) while older homes may need higher (30-40).

Q4: Should I round up the calculated tons?
A: HVAC systems come in standard sizes (1.5, 2, 2.5, 3, etc.). Choose the next standard size if between sizes.

Q5: Does this account for windows and insulation?
A: The BTU factor should account for these. For precise calculations, consult an HVAC professional.
